Sega Restructures, Loses Jobs

Game publisher Sega will restructure its Western operations, which will end up cutting jobs and move the company toward digital distribution, reports MCVUK.com.

A total of 73 will be cut with 37 coming from the London office and 36 from the San Francisco location. San Fran will become the Digital Division, while London will focus on packaged games. The move is an internal one for the Western operations and not one demanded from Japanese parent Sega Sammy Holdings.

Sega has found success with games for iPhones and iPads and will continue to pursue that market aggressively. Additionally, online distribution channels such as Steam and Direct2Drive are becoming a growing part of the company’s future.
